The series went the wrong way with DR2.

Taking away all the challenge from rescuing survivors. Increasing the length of the zombie grab attack making it a constant tiresome element, and for no good reason since the primary hazard of getting caught by one in the first game was that it seriously endangered your survivors. Add to that how fucking slow you run at the start of the game compounded with the larger map and you have a miserable experience.
The availability of overpowered combo weapons makes the random items that you find around the map less useful. This is reinforced by the normal items also often being less powerful than in the original. Scrambling for weapons and using desperate tactics should be encouraged, it plays into the zombie theme. Combining items could in theory fit thematically, but they are too overpowered, poorly implemented and nonsensical. I think that the original could benefit from slightly nerfing the boss weapons as well, but that is not as big of a problem.

Chuck plays like shit compared to Frank. The voice acting is shit, just compare the energy difference between the two calling out for survivors. His character and the story that he goes through are dull as shit. He controls worse, played on pc with a 360 controller its even hard running in a straight line because he is so skittish. Part of what makes him less fun to play is also that animation quality between the two is down, there is something buttery over all of Franks moves, it adds a great deal of character to him (just look at that sexy hunched over run cycle) and makes Chuck seem very stiff in comparison.
I wonder if there are differences in attack animations between the two as well, because the simple act of hitting things in DR2 is less fun than in the original. Part of that is the removal of the little stutter that occurs in DR1 and the lower quality sound effects in DR2, but maybe there is something more to it.

With slightly worse music, boring reuse of assets, less interesting environment, less cheese and more in your face wackyness, it just feels like a lower quality product.

On the good side I like the embedded track and the improvements to the gameplay of the boss fights.

I might be the only person that actually likes the AI because yeah sure, the pathfinding is shit but I love how some survivors are cowardly and would rather cry than do what you tell them to do and some will go out of their way to kill a zombie/cultist instead of staying in a safe space. Some require you to carry them and some are neutral and basically do what they're told. Not only that, but some cowards are more cowardly than others and some survivors are more aggressive than others etc. Each survivor reacts differently than the other. In DR2 they just follow you and never have any issues, boring.

You actually have to put effort into saving them. Some of the survivors will even curl up into a ball or crawl on the ground and ignore you if you don't give them a weapon or clear a path for them. People really don't give the AI enough credit but they'll run through a horde of zombies without killing a single one and blame the AI when they get grabbed.

I can start a new game from level 1 and kill every boss and save every survivor in one sitting without much issues, you just have to understand how the AI works.
